Best Sutherlin Public High Schools (2026-27)

For the 2026-27 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 458 students in Sutherlin, OR.
The top-ranked public high school in Sutherlin, OR is Sutherlin High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Sutherlin, OR public high schools have an average math proficiency score of 30% (versus the Oregon public high school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 45% (versus the 48% statewide average). High schools in Sutherlin have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Oregon public high schools.
Sutherlin, OR public high school have a Graduation Rate of 73%, which is less than the Oregon average of 82%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Sutherlin High School, with 90-94%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Oregon or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 21%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Oregon public high school average of 41% (majority Hispanic).
